Composition and technology of drying fruit of the medicinal plant “Capparis spinosa L.” and its study

Abstract This paper considers the study of the composition and development of technology for drying the fruit of the medicinal plant "spiny capers - Capparis spinosa L." grown in the Namangan region (Uzbekistan). The conducted experiments proved the presence in the composition of the medicinal plant fruit "spiny capers - Capparis spinosa L." of vital vitamins, macro- and microelements. For ease and convenience of transportation, as well as for long-term storage, a technological drying process has been developed to dry the fruit of the medicinal plant "spiny capers - Capparis spinosa L." The process of drying the fruit of the medicinal plant "spiny capers - Capparis spinosa L." was carried out at the installation of a multi-belt dryer by supplying a heat carrier with a temperature of 55-60°C for 120-180 minutes. Hot air is used as a heat carrier. Also, the optimum temperature for drying the fruit of the medicinal plant "spiny capers - Capparis spinosa L." was studied. As a result of the experiments, it was shown that burning in the fruits of spiny capers medicinal plant is observed when dried at a temperature of 80°C and above. It has also been proven that the drying temperature of the fruit of the studied medicinal plant in the range of 60-70°C is optimal.
